#d5cdc9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5cdc9 is composed of 83.5% red, 80.4%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.8% magenta, 5.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 12.5% and a lightness of 81.2%. #d5cdc9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ab9b93.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d5cdc9 color description : Grayish orange.
#d5cdc9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5cdc9 has RGB values of R:213, G:205,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.06,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14011849.
